Mini Quesadillas, Pizza Slices Recalled for Possible E. Coli

Farm Rich voluntarily announced a recall of products distributed nationwide in November.

Rich Products Corporation of New York announced a voluntary recall of a variety of frozen foods produced in November due to possible E. Coli contamination.

The Farm Rich products: Mini Quesadillas, Mini Pizza Slices, Philly Cheese Steaks, Mozzarella Bites and Markey Day Mozzarella Bites produced from Nov. 12, 2012, to Nov. 19, 2012, all may contain the bacteria E. Coli.

Symptoms of the illness include mild to severe diarrhea and abdominal cramps. Blood is often seen in the stool, but little or no fever is present. Although most healthy adults can recover completely within five to 10 days, certain individuals can develop a complication called Hemolytic Uremic Syndrome (HUS) which can cause the kidneys to fail.

The complication is most likely to occur in young children and the elderly. The condition could lead to serious kidney damage and even death, according to the Food & Drug Administration.

The Farm Rich products were distributed in retail stores nationwide. These products are partially baked, dough enrobed, snack items that consumers bake or microwave at home.

Specific product information is as follows:

Farm Rich® Mini Quesadillas are packaged in 18 oz. bags. The product code is 35635, the production date is November 14, 2012 with a Julian Date of 15822319. The UPC Code is 041322356352 and the “Best By” date on the package is May 14, 2014.

Farm Rich® Mini Pizza Slices are packaged in 22 oz. bags. The product code is 35643, the production date is November 15, 2012 with a Julian Date of 15822320 and November 16, 2012 with a Julian Date 1582 2321. The UPC Code is 041322356437 and the “Best By” date on the package is May 15 or May 16, 2014.

The Farm Rich® Mini Pizza Slices are also packaged in a 7.2 oz. carton. The product code is 37690, the production date is also November 15, 2012 with a Julian Date of 1582 2320 and November 16, 2012 with a Julian Date 1582 2321. The UPC Code is 041322376909 and the “Best By” date on the package is May 15 or May 16, 2014.

Farm Rich® Philly Cheese Steaks are packaged in 21 oz. bags. The product code is 35634, the production date is November 13, 2012 with a Julian Date of 1582 2318. The UPC Code is 041322356345 and the “Best By” date on the package is May 13, 2014.

Farm Rich® Mozzarella Bites are packaged in 22 oz. bags. The product code is 37443, the production date is November 19, 2012 with a Julian Date of 1582 2324. TheUPC Code is 041322374431 and the “Best By” date on the package is May 19, 2014.

Farm Rich® Mozzarella Bites are packaged in a 7 oz. carton. The product code is 37691, the production date is November 19, 2012 with a Julian Date of 1582 2324. TheUPC Code is 041322376916 and the “Best By” date on the package is May 19, 2014.

Market Day® Mozzarella Bites are packaged in a 22 oz. carton. The product code is 80435, the production date is November 12, 2012 with a Julian Date of 1582 2317. TheUPC Code is 041322804358 and the “Best By” date on the package is May 12, 2014.

"At Rich’s, food safety and the safety of our consumers is of paramount importance," the company said in a statement. "Since discovering that illnesses may be linked to our products, we have been working quickly and extensively with the Food Safety Inspection Service at USDA, as well as the Food and Drug Administration. We also are working as fast as possible to investigate and identify the possible source of contamination. We will be keeping all customers and the public fully informed as we learn more in the coming days."

Rich’s has already notified all of its distributors and retailers who have received the product in question and has directed them to remove and destroy the affected product.
